Retro Polar Express North Pole Christmas: A Designer's Guide

The nostalgic charm of a Retro Polar Express North Pole Christmas design offers more than just festive cheer; it provides a powerful visual language that taps into collective memory and emotion. For graphic designers and brand strategists, this specific aesthetic—characterized by vintage typography, classic train motifs, and a warm, storybook color palette—serves as a versatile asset. It bridges the gap between traditional holiday sentiment and modern design needs, allowing for the creation of compelling visual narratives that resonate deeply with audiences. Understanding its core components is key to effective application. The retro style often employs limited color palettes with muted reds, greens, and creams, paired with hand-lettered or serif typography that evokes a mid-century feel. This visual approach is not merely decorative; it establishes a clear visual hierarchy and a strong brand identity that feels authentic and trustworthy. In an era of sleek, minimalist digital interfaces, such a theme can cut through the noise, offering a tactile, human-centered experience.

Tips for Effective Integration and Evaluation

When incorporating a Retro Polar Express North Pole Christmas asset, thoughtful evaluation ensures it aligns with your design goals and audience expectations. Consider the following:
  1. Maintain Consistency: Ensure the asset’s style complements your existing brand system. It should enhance, not clash with, your core visual design principles.
  2. Check Scalability: A high-resolution file (like 3600x3600 pixels) is crucial. Verify it scales down cleanly for UI design icons or up for large-format print design.
  3. Prioritize Readability: If the design includes text, ensure the typography remains legible across all applications, from a small social media graphic to a poster.
  4. Balance Composition: Use the thematic elements as a focal point within a clean layout. Strong visual hierarchy will guide the viewer’s eye and improve the overall user experience.
